Bahrain press headlines.
Manama - BNA

Bahrain dailies issued today focused in their principal headlines on the main local, Arab and international events which happened over the past 24 hours.

The following is a round-up of the main topics:

 -  Premier issues two edicts restructuring the Minor’s Council and forming the Vocational and Safety Council.

-Crown Prince: Looking forward with utmost optimism to achieving comprehensive security and continuing the growth momentum.

-Mohammed bin Mubarak receives Isa Award for Service to Humanity jury chief and member

- BDF Commander-in-Chief inspects military units.

-Khalid bin Hamad arrives in Grozny and hails joint Bahraini-Chechen ties.

-Electricity and water Affairs Minister briefed about power-saving technologies. -Education Minister: biggest Braille printer in the Middle East provided for blind students in Bahrain.

-Industry and Commerce Minister meets owners of hypermarkets.

-Industry and Commerce Minister meets GCC Secretary-General.

-Industry and Commerce Minister hails innovative youth projects.

-Bahrain signs two financial agreements with Saudi and the UAE

-Saudi, the UAE and Kuwait pump $10 billion to bolster Bahrain’s financial stability.

-Ministerial committee for financial affairs and rationalized spending: the financial plan to balance Government spending and revenues by 2022.

-Ombudsman launches 5th report which shows a decrease in the number of complaints.

-BCCI chairman discusses economic cooperation with Morocco.

-More than 97% verified their data on the voters’ lists on the elections portal.

-British Ambassador to Britain: the exhibition of the Rashid Al-Khalifa reveals Bahrain’s art to the world.

-Supreme Council for Women holds workshop on drafting women-related reports.

-Arab Parliament hails efforts to remove mines.

-Four Turkish soldiers killed and five injured in explosion in the east of the country.

-Washington levels charges against 7 Russian intelligence agents in connection with the international piracy case.

-Massive international relief aid in quake-hit Indonesia.
